1.下載openresty http://openresty.org/cn/download.html 2.上傳解壓 rz -E tar -xzvf openresty-{version}.tar.gz 其中version為下載的版本號 3.進入openresty目錄下,編譯安裝 ...
一個很簡單的需求,就是靜態頁面請求url 的rewrite 方便使用,類似mvc 的路由,不同的請求,對應到后邊不同的website,但是是一個地址 作用:類似一種micro frontend 的一些部分功能實現,這樣靜態web site 就有了一個統一而且靈活的入口 ,比較適合sass,或者用戶有特定 需求的場景 格式處理 原有請求格式參考 html 后綴是可選的 http: lt domain ...
2020-07-17 11:30 0 850 推薦指數:
1.下載openresty http://openresty.org/cn/download.html 2.上傳解壓 rz -E tar -xzvf openresty-{version}.tar.gz 其中version為下載的版本號 3.進入openresty目錄下,編譯安裝 ...
文章原創於公眾號:程序猿周先森。本平台不定時更新,喜歡我的文章,歡迎關注我的微信公眾號。 上一篇文章對Nginx的Location配置進行了講解,本篇主要對於Nginx中的Rewrite跳轉進行講解。因為目前很多工作前端開發都會選擇使用Nginx作為反向代理服務器,但是平時業務需要難免碰到重寫 ...
使用不同的url前綴來訪問不同的文件路徑,我的配置文件如下: 注意根路徑需要使用alias 而不是 root ...
目錄 rewrite介紹 Rerite標記Flag Rewrite規則實踐(大部分需開發實現功能) 案例一: 案例二: 案例三: 案例四: 案例 ...
最常見的: 靜態地址重定向到帶參數的動態地址 rewrite "^(.*)/service/(.*)\.html$" $1/service.php?sid=$2 permanent; 反過來: 帶參數的動態地址重定向到靜態地址 if ($query_string ~* id ...
最常見的: 靜態地址重定向到帶參數的動態地址 rewrite "^(.*)/service/(.*)\.html$" $1/service.php?sid=$2 permanent; 反過來: 帶參數的動態地址重定向到靜態地址 ...
一個示例: 已=開頭表示精確匹配如 A 中只匹配根目錄結尾的請求,后面不能帶任何字符串。 ^~ 開頭表示uri以某個常規字符串開頭,不是正則匹配 ~ 開頭表示區分大小寫的正則匹配; ~* 開頭表示不區分大小寫的正則匹配 / 通用匹配, 如果沒有其它匹配 ...
偽靜態是一種可以把文件后綴改成任何可能的一種方法,如果我想把PHP文件偽靜態成html文件,這種相當簡單的,下面來介紹nginx 偽靜態配置方法有需要了解的朋友可參考。 nginx里使用偽靜態是直接在nginx.conf 中寫規則的,並不需要像apache要開啟寫模塊(mod_rewrite ...